Origin of Kennel
-  From Anglo-Norman, from a Old Northern French variant of Old French chenil (whence modern French chenil), from Vulgar Latin *canile, ultimately from Latin canis From Wiktionary 
-  Middle English kenel from Anglo-Norman kenil from Medieval Latin canīle from Latin canis dog kwon- in Indo-European roots From American Heritage Dictionary of the English Language, 5th Edition 
-  Middle English cannel from Old North French canel channel from Latin canālis canal From American Heritage Dictionary of the English Language, 5th Edition
